1828 - The first edition of Noah Webster's dictionary was published under the name "American Dictionary of the English Language."
1902 - James Cash (J.C.) Penney opened his first retail store in Kemmerer, WY. It was called the Golden Rule Store.
1939 - The John Steinbeck novel "The Grapes of Wrath" was first published.
1960 - The musical "Bye Bye Birdie" opened in New York City.
1981 - America's first space shuttle, Columbia, returned to Earth after its first flight. The shuttle orbited the Earth 36 times during the mission.
